2012-11-04 55 views
3

我有一個PHP的問題有關的fsockopen的fsockopen不工作絲毫的FastCGI(PHP)

服務器:

VPS的CentOS 6.3(最終)PLESK 11

問題:

如果我使用的FastCGI函數fsockopen不起作用。 我得到:警告:fsockopen():無法連接到xx.xx.xx.xx:80(權限被拒絕)

如果我編輯網站(用於測試)在plesk 11並將其設置爲Apache它工作。

我找不到解決此問題的方法。有人有線索?

回答

7

禁用SELinux或添加新規則,讓Apache的開放遠程連接

添加規則使用

setsebool -P httpd_can_network_connect 1 

禁用SELinux或將其設置爲許可模式編輯您的

/etc/selinux/config 
+0

像魅力一樣工作! – tolginho

+0

謝謝你,它爲我工作並節省了很多時間... –